### Runbook: Validator Plugin Failures (Gatewarden)

If the Gatewarden validator registry reports repeated plugin load errors, first check that the plugin manifest version matches the host ABI. Disable the failing plugin with the registry toggle; core validators will absorb the load. Do not restart the whole ingest tier — plugins reload independently. Capture the plugin's last stderr output and attach it to the incident. Confirm the host is running the build referenced below.

pipeline stamp: htk31_f769b577b3028a4e9958e5bb8d1259a

Leadership Review Briefing — Corvella Line Pricing

Heads of department,

Quick pre-read before Thursday. The Corvella line has been underpriced versus the Brightmoor range for two cycles now, and margins show it. We're proposing a 6–9% uplift on mid-tier SKUs, holding entry models flat to protect volume. Early soundings with key accounts suggest tolerance is there, provided we bundle the extended warranty. Marketing wants sign-off on messaging by month-end, so come ready to commit. Before you weigh in, keep this next point to yourselves:

internal memo for hahif-hahaf: Headcount on the Zorwyn team goes from 9 to 100 by the end of October. Gross margin on Zorwyn came in at 5 percent against a plan of 10 percent.

Hi Tomas — handing over the Briarlens 2.4 release. The new diff viewer streams large files instead of loading them whole, so support should stop seeing the "tab froze on 200 MB diff" complaints. Known gap: binary files over 1 GB still show a placeholder. Escalate anything else to the viewer channel. Release artifacts for 2.4 must be verified before support shares download links, using the key below.

rollout seal: bky4_x7Gc

- [ ] Step 7: Archive cold storage buckets (Glacierline tier). Confirm both ceremony witnesses are present, verify bucket manifests match the Oxbow ledger, then seal the archive key shares. Plugin authors may observe but not handle shares. Once sealed, the archive index itself is encrypted and can only be reopened with the passphrase below.

vault phrase of badup-hahig = tamael-aldael-kelmir-istael-fenok-istwyn-tamius-jorath-oliion